Priyanka Gandhi Vadra has been in news recently as speculations were on that she would join active politics. Report of Priyanka taking the plunge into active politics surfaced after senior Congress leaders openly called for her participation in the party affairs in a bigger role.
The daughter of Congress president Sonia Gandhi and sister of Congress vice president Rahul Gandhi had campaigned for her mother and brother in the general elections and proved to be good at the job.
However Ms Vadra dismissed all speculation as ‘conjecture’ and ‘baseless rumours’. But many within the party remain unconvinced and insisted that she would take to politics at a later stage. This makes us wonder, why are Congress leaders so hopeful that Priyanka will join the party? Can she indeed revive the party's fortune?
Priyanka Gandhi's strength lies in her telegenic presence. It's so formidable that it can challenge PM Narendra Modi’s popularity in mass media. Priyanka was a hit during the election campaigns and she held her own whenever she crossed swords with Modi.
Priyanka has a striking resemblance to her grandmother, Indira Gandhi, which may prove to be an asset. Indira had created an ideal female Gandhi politician – using reserve and charm as needed while demonstrating strength and firmness. How Priyanka will work as a politician is only a speculation at present, but compared to Rahul she seems more prepared for everyday politics. Priyanka has displayed comfort with crowds and and also showed expertise in handling the media.
Ms Vadra is also good at giving sound bites. So in future we may see Narendra Modi, Arvind Kejriwal (if he revives) and Priyanka Gandhi as the three dominant figures in Indian airwaves.
At present, Congress is a case of missing in politics and if Priyanka comes takes the plunge then the party may get its visibility back, especially in between the Parliament session when there is not much scope for opposition to get media attention..
The main threat before Priyanka Gandhi is her husband Robert Vadra. While Priyanka may not be connected in any way to Robert Vadra's questionable land deals. But to navigate herself out of the muck will be quite a challenge for Priyanka Gandhi. She may lose her focus and composure due to the legal proceedings and well-timed leaks by her antagonists.
Another stick point will be her equation with Rahul Gandhi. It could throw her in an awkward position as loyalists will move to both the poles. A time may come when the Congress may openly voice its preference for her. Such a transition will have to be managed seamlessly so that the opposition does not get an opportunity to exploit the cracks.
The greatest challenge for Priyanka as well as the Gandhis is to negotiate the disinterest of India's middle class towards the dynasty. The youth in India resent being ruled by the privileged class. Besides, an Italian mother makes matters all the more complicated and often gives validity to cries of they are not ‘one of us’.
